Kia Cadenza: Limitations of the system / On inclines
- During uphill or downhill driving,
Smart Cruise Control may not
detect a moving vehicle in your
lane, and cause your vehicle to
accelerate to the set speed. Also,
the vehicle speed will rapidly down
when the vehicle ahead is recognized
suddenly.
- Select the appropriate set speed
on inclines and adjust your vehicle
speed by depressing the accelerator
or brake pedal according to the
road condition ahead and driving
condition.
